My story is that I bought an A6 from Digital Village yesterday.
I was so excited to get the thing home so I unpacked it, set it up and
off I went
Quick glance at the manual says I need to auto-tune no problem so I
did that.
Im not interested in other preset USER sounds, so I deleted them and
started of with my own default tone.
Funny thing tho just playing that patch from one key to another and
the tuning is sooo wrong not just the drift that you used to get on
the old stuff, but by as much as ½ to ¾ of a semitone!
Ok, no great problem, Ill come back to that I think to myself. So I
start trying to make a new sound, but I cant get away from that blasted
tuning problem.
So I think right! Im going to solve this I do EVERYTHING resets,
autotune and even turning off the offending voices in GLOBAL. But that
doesnt work because the voices I left as alright start to move out of
tune too its like playing cat and mouse.
